What is smoke damage from fire?

Smoke damage from fire involves the soot, ash, and odors left behind after a fire. These particles can settle on surfaces, penetrate materials, and cause discoloration or etching. Lingering smoke odors can be pervasive and difficult to remove without professional cleaning. Prompt and thorough remediation is essential to restore air quality and prevent long-term damage to your property.

What does fire damage near me look like?

Fire damage near you might appear as charring, soot, or smoke stains on walls, ceilings, and belongings. You might also notice water damage from firefighting efforts. The extent can vary from minor surface soot to significant structural compromise. Professionals will assess all affected areas, including those not immediately visible, to determine the full scope of restoration needed.

What does water fire restoration involve?

Water fire restoration involves addressing the combined effects of fire and water damage. Professionals first extract water and dry the affected areas to prevent mold. Then, they clean soot and smoke residue from surfaces and contents. This dual approach is crucial for preventing further deterioration and restoring your property safely. It ensures all aspects of the damage are handled.
